The Struggle Continues. La Plaza Cultural community garden on 9th street and Avenue C. The fence surrounding it is topped with hundreds of whimsical sculptures made of recycled materials. |
|
They are more aesthetic than razor wire. Earlier in the GammaBlaBlog. |

The local fire house. Engine 28 and Ladder 11. The house patch says “Bomberos Primeros” Babelfish translates this as “Firemen First. |
-
” Ladder 11 is known for playing the William Tell Overture (Lone Ranger theme) and Low Rider by WAR over their PA, while cruising the neighborhood. Their logo is a pair of dice rolling 11. Six men from ladder 11 are listed here among the 403 names of missing and killed members of New York City’s uniformed services from 9-11. East Second Street between Avenues B and C.
